Ignore ‘terrible twins’: Derek O’Brien, deport Amit Shah, say others

Once back in power, BJP would impose NRC ( National register of Citizens) and throw out each infiltrator, declared Amit Shah in Darjeeling, following which he was ruthlessly trolled on Twitter

Deport Amit Shah to Iran to start with, said a Twitter user on Thursday, referring to the migration of people from Iran to Gujarat. Others were less subtle. “Amit Tukde Tukde Shah” tweeted a few referring to his statement made in an election rally in Darjeeling.

“We will remove every single infiltrator from the country, except Buddha, Hindus and Sikhs," he was quoted as saying by BJP’s official Twitter handle.

“Didn't know #Buddha was an infiltrator who is now being exempted from deportation under NRC!” tweeted CPI(ML) General Secretary Dipankar Bhattacharya with his tongue firmly in cheek.

While a few wondered how the Election Commission was allowing both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Amit Shah to get away after making such divisive, communal, unconstitutional and provocative statements, at least one Twitter user sarcastically said that at least Shah is being honest!

“This is honesty. No rubbish about development, fighting corruption, creating jobs. Just bare, brutal hatred and bigotry.,” she tweeted.

A few other comments on Twitter were :

  • Feel sorry for Parsis, if they had tried entering Gujarat as refugees today!
  • I hope those of you who dismiss this warning as far-fetched, alarmist, and 'biased' when it comes from journalists and writers, will pay attention when it comes from Amit Shah.
  • Referring to the tweet from BJP’s official handle, a Twitter user took a swipe at BJP’s IT Cell chief Amit Malviya and tweeted: a) Amit Bhai can't tell difference between Buddha & Buddhists b) this statement clearly tells Muslim minorities in Myanmar & Muslims in India too that They would be treated as 'infiltrators' while non-Muslims are welcome.
  • Quick question Chowkidar @AmitShah sir, will Parsis also be thrown out in #NewIndia? What about atheists? Asking for friend. thanks in advance.
  • Rajya Sabha MP and Trinamool Congress leader Derek O’Brien reacted by saying, “ Dear Young India (& not so young India) Terrible Twins (Jumla Jodi) deliberately make communally divisive statements every day. Suggestion: Ignore. Stay on main conversation: jobs,farmer distress, under-performing economy & destruction of institutions. Save the Constitution.”
